You may want to double-check that the patch actually "took". Three
Windows 2000 servers here reported that the MS03-026 patch was applied
according to Windows Update and Add/Remove Programs. In fact, the DLLs
that needed to be updated had not been touched.
Make sure these three files in the System32 folder have a date of
7/5/2003:
rpcrt4.dll
ole32.dll
rpcss.dll
If they don't, you may need to replace them manually.
